INCI: Mica, polyester 3, titanium dioxide, iron oxide, tartrazine, acid red 92.
Micron Size: 1-60

Cosmetic use:
โ€ข N/A - Use for Soap Only

Ideal for:
โ€ข Soap
โ€ข Resin
โ€ข Crafts
โ€ข Wax Melts

Prop 65: Titanium dioxide (airborne, unbound particles of respirable size) is on the Proposition 65 list because it can cause cancer. Exposure to titanium dioxide may increase the risk of cancer. Once incorporated into a liquid or solid base it is no longer airborne and falls off the Prop 65 list.

Because this is a Nurture Soap custom color, we do not provide CoA information. Please take this into account if you need a safety assessment performed for your soap (i.e. European Union).

โ€ข Use rate in cold & hot process soaps: 1-2 teaspoons per pound of oils.
โ€ข Use rate in melt & pour soaps: .5 teaspoons per pound of oils.

~ More or less can be added to achieve your desired color. These usage rates are recommended for no colored lather. ~
